Flat White vs Latte: The Core Difference
Understanding the Context
At first glance, both Flat White and Latte feature rich espresso and steamed milk, but the secret lies in the texture and ratio. A traditional Flat White uses very little microfoam, emphasizing the intense, smooth espresso flavor with a velvety but minimal milk base. By contrast, a Latte packs in more foam, offering a silky, frothy texture and a milder coffee kick, ideal for those who prefer a gentler milk presence.
But beyond texture, the coffee-to-milk ratio is where the real drama plays out. With less milk, a Flat White delivers a bolder, richer taste—more concentrated, with pronounced coffee notes. Lattes dilute the intensity slightly with extra milk, softening the edge while prolonging the drink’s creamy mouthfeel.

Who Should Choose Flat White?
If you’re someone who loves a strong cup of coffee with confidence—preferring espresso’s bold character over added creaminess—then Flat White is your ticket. It suits those who value precision, richness, and a clean, focused flavor. Ideal for coffee purists who want to savor the essence of espresso in every drink.
Who Else Should Try a Latte?
On the other hand, if you prefer milk-heavy, smoother beverages with a comforting foam finish, a Latte offers a gentle, approachable experience. It’s great for those who love velvety textures and milder coffee hits—perfect for casual mornings or kid-friendly outings.
